1. Messy Bun

A messy bun is the ultimate go-to look for moms. It’s quick, versatile, and adds just enough flair to your everyday outfit. Whether you’re in leggings and a hoodie or rocking a casual dress, this style effortlessly elevates your look with barely any effort.

Simply gather your hair into a high ponytail, twist it loosely, and wrap it into a bun. Use a scrunchie or a large clip to secure it — no need to be perfect! The beauty of the messy bun lies in its undone look. Flyaways? Embrace them. They add personality and texture.

For moms with thick or curly hair, letting a few curls peek out can add volume and a fun vibe. Add a touch of dry shampoo for texture and you’re good to go. It’s one of the easiest hairstyles for moms, especially on busy school mornings.

2. Low Ponytail with a Twist

The low ponytail is timeless — but add a twist (literally), and you’ve got something special. This look is sleek, quick, and adds a sense of polish without extra time.

Start with a simple low ponytail at the nape of your neck. Before securing it fully, create a small gap above the hair tie and flip the ponytail through. That tiny twist makes the look feel more styled and intentional.

You can also wrap a strand of hair around the base of the ponytail to hide the elastic for a cleaner finish. It’s a perfect look for those last-minute errands, virtual meetings, or school pickups. Best of all, it works great on both freshly washed and second-day hair.

3. Braided Headband

This style is a hidden gem for moms who want to keep their hair out of their face while still looking chic. It’s ideal for medium to long hair, and once you get the hang of the technique, it’s as easy as tying your shoes.

Start by parting your hair and grabbing a section near your temple. Braid it, then pull it across your head like a headband and pin it on the opposite side. Let the rest of your hair fall naturally, or tuck it into a ponytail or bun.

A braided headband is perfect for park days, playdates, or brunch with friends. It’s also a mom favorite because it works wonders with second- or third-day hair, especially when you’re skipping the wash.

4. Half-Up Top Knot

The half-up top knot is for the indecisive mom — when you want your hair down but also need it out of your face. This hybrid style combines the fun of a messy bun with the freedom of loose hair.

Take the top section of your hair (from your temples upward), twist it into a knot, and secure it with a hair tie or mini clip. Let the rest of your hair flow freely. This style works with curls, waves, or straight strands.

It’s especially helpful on hectic mornings when you don’t have time for a full wash or style. The half-up top knot creates a youthful, carefree vibe that moms love — and it’s virtually foolproof.

5. Classic French Braid

The French braid is a timeless beauty — and not just for little girls. It’s a neat, functional hairstyle that holds up all day and works for almost any hair type.

Start at the crown of your head, weaving hair in sections as you move down. Once you’ve secured the braid, gently tug the loops to loosen and add volume for a more modern, relaxed look.

French braids are perfect for busy moms on-the-go. They keep hair out of your face during workouts, grocery runs, or while chasing toddlers at the playground. Plus, it looks like you put in a lot more effort than you actually did.

6. Sleek Low Bun

Need a polished look in under five minutes? The sleek low bun has your back. It’s ideal for professional settings or special occasions, but it’s so easy, you can wear it daily.

Simply smooth your hair back with a brush, pull it into a low ponytail, and twist it into a bun. Secure with bobby pins or an elastic. Add a little hair gel or serum to tame frizz and create a glossy finish.

Whether you’re prepping for a virtual meeting or heading out for dinner, the low bun is a chic and timeless option. And the best part? It’s easy to master, even with just one free hand while wrangling the kids.

7. Side Braid

Looking for a soft, romantic look? The side braid is simple yet elegant. It’s especially great for medium to long hair and offers a laid-back charm that works from sunrise to sundown.

Part your hair to one side and braid it loosely over your shoulder. You can go with a traditional three-strand braid or try a fishtail variation for extra texture. Pull out a few strands around your face to soften the look.

This is one of those cute hairstyles for moms that transitions effortlessly from playdates to date nights — and it holds up well in all kinds of weather.

8. Claw Clip Twist

Say hello to the comeback queen: the claw clip! This ’90s accessory is not only back, it’s better than ever — and it’s a lifesaver for moms.

To style, twist your hair up from the base of your neck and clip it in place. Let the ends fan out casually over the top or tuck them in for a sleeker look. It takes seconds and gives you a clean, carefree style.

Perfect for working moms or multitaskers, the claw clip is one of the most practical (and stylish) tools in your drawer. Keep one in your diaper bag or glove box — you’ll be surprised how often you use it.

9. High Ponytail

There’s nothing like a high ponytail to make you feel ready to conquer the day. This look is energetic, playful, and always in style.

Pull your hair up high and secure it tightly with an elastic. For a sleeker look, brush out bumps and smooth with a little serum. You can wrap a strand of hair around the base to polish it off.

High ponytails work on almost any hair length and texture. Add dry shampoo for volume or curl the ends if you have time to spare. It’s a power look that’s as functional as it is fierce.

10. Loose Waves with Dry Shampoo

Didn’t have time to wash your hair? No problem. Loose waves and a little dry shampoo go a long way — and they look effortlessly beautiful.

Spritz dry shampoo at your roots and give your hair a good shake. If you’ve got a few extra minutes, run a curling wand through the front pieces to define them. Otherwise, scrunch and go!

This look is perfect for when you’re short on time but still want that lived-in, effortless vibe. It’s one of the best second-day hairstyles and gives your hair that fresh-from-the-beach feeling.

11. Scarf-Wrapped Bun

Want to spice up your style without much effort? Add a scarf! A scarf-wrapped bun adds color, texture, and flair — and hides a multitude of mom hair sins.

Create a simple bun, then wrap a lightweight scarf around the base. Tie it into a bow, let it hang, or tuck it in — the possibilities are endless. It’s a quick way to feel pulled together, even if your hair is three days post-wash.

Perfect for summer, travel, or even backyard playdates, this look brings out your fun, creative side. Plus, scarves are great for taming frizz and adding personality.

12. Double Dutch Braids

For active moms or gym-goers, double Dutch braids are both stylish and secure. They keep your hair in place all day and look youthful and sporty.

Start with a center part, and braid each side down from the crown to the nape, keeping the strands tight and even. This style works well on freshly washed or day-old hair.

It’s one of those practical mom hairstyles that can handle a workout, a windy day, or a chaotic schedule — all while looking adorable.

13. Quick Blowout with Round Brush

Have 10 extra minutes? A fast blowout can make you feel brand new. Use a round brush and a hair dryer to add volume, bounce, and shape to your hair.

Focus on lifting the roots and curling the ends under. A heat protectant spray and volumizing mousse can enhance results without adding time.

Though it’s slightly more involved than the others on this list, the payoff is worth it. You’ll feel polished, refreshed, and ready to take on anything — even a surprise PTA meeting.

14. Rolled Updo

Elegant doesn’t have to mean complicated. A rolled updo offers a sophisticated look with surprisingly little effort.

Use a headband to create this style: tuck small sections of hair up and over the band until it’s all rolled in. Secure with bobby pins, and voilà! An instant chic updo.

This is perfect for special events, photoshoots, or just treating yourself to a day where you feel beautiful. It’s a graceful option that feels like you stepped out of a magazine — in minutes.

15. Pixie Cut Styling

If you’ve gone for the chop — good for you! A pixie cut is low-maintenance and bold, but it still allows room for style and variety.

Use a little texturizing paste or mousse to create volume, lift, or a tousled effect. Slick it back, add a side part, or spike it up depending on your mood.

This is the ultimate wash-and-go hairstyle. Short hair doesn’t mean boring — it means fast, fabulous, and free!
